Planting Calendar for Fanflower

Frost tolerance for fanflower: Not tolerant of frost.
When to plant: After the last frost when the weather gets warmer.

You can not plant fanflower until after the last frost has passed because they require warm weather.

The earliest that you can plant fanflower in Cleburne is April. However, you really should wait until May if you don't want to take any chances.

The last month that you can plant fanflower and expect a good harvest is probably August. Any later than that and your fanflower may not have a chance to really do well. Starting your fanflower indoors is a great way to get them started a couple of weeks earlier.

Last Frost Date

On average the last frost when the weather gets warmer is on March 15 in Cleburne. You should expect an average low temperature of 10°F in the coldest months of winter.

Remember that the actual date of last frost is just an average because it is based on the USDA zone info for Cleburne and it is different every year. Half of the time in Cleburne last frost occurs after March 15 so just be sure to be ready to cover your fanflower in the event of a surprise late frost.

USDA Zone Info for Cleburne

Here is the info for USDA Zone 8a.

Average Date of Last Frost (spring)March 15
Average Date of First Frost (fall)November 15
Lowest Expected Low10°F
Highest Expected Low15°F

This means that on a really cold year, the coldest it will get is 10°F. On most years you should be prepared to experience lows near 15°F.
